Welcome back to the NBA Desktop! This week, Jason breaks down the biggest events and controversies at All-Star Weekend. First he examines the mounting evidence that Giannis Antetokounmpo might actually hate fellow league MVP James Harden. Next, did Dwyane Wade conspire to cheat Aaron Gordon out of a dunk-contest win in favor of his former Heat teammate Derrick Jones Jr.? Then actor, comedian, and All-Star celebrity game participant Hannibal Buress joins to discuss his performance during the celebrity game. Plus, a possible new Knicks coach, Steph Curry’s saucy Instagram vacation photo, and Tim Duncan’s declaration of support for presidential candidate Mike Bloomberg.
